Brussels, 06/09/2006 (Agence Europe) - On 4 September the European Parliament's budget committee approved a transfer of a total amount of €50 million in humanitarian aid to the Lebanese people (out of a total, €20 million has already been transferred to respond to the most urgent needs). The funds, managed by the Commission's humanitarian aid directorate general (DG ECHO), cover a whole series of emergency rescue assistance activities, notably the provision of first aid products to displaced persons and medical aid. The Commission has proposed that an Emergency Aid Reserve fund is used because the remainder in the humanitarian aid budget has almost been exhausted and the hurricane season is beginning in the Pacific and Caribbean.
